There's no place like home for South Elgin, who bounced back after a loss on the road last Saturday. They walked away with a 2-0 win over the Streamwood Sabres on Tuesday. That result was just more of the same for these two, as the Storm also won the last time the pair played back in October of 2023.
The 2-0 score doesn't show just how dominant South Elgin was: they took both sets by at least 11 points. The match finished with set scores of 25-13, 25-14.
Rylie Almoradie was the offensive standout of the matchup as she had eight digs and two aces. That's the most aces she has posted in her last nine games.
South Elgin's victory was their third straight at home, which pushed their record up to 11-13. As for Streamwood,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 6-16.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. South Elgin will head out to challenge West Aurora at 5:30 p.m. on Tuesday. As for Streamwood, they will take on Elk Grove at 9:30 a.m. on Saturday.
